Question
When X has a binomial distribution with total number n of trials and success probability p, we use the notation, X\sim B(n,p).
Suppose that independent random variables X and Y have binomial distributions such that X\sim B(n,p) and Y\sim B(n,q), where 0<p<1 and 0<q<1.
Answer the following true/false questions.
(n-X+Y) \sim B(2n,q) when p+q=1 <True or False>
The mgf X+Y of 2(pe^t + (1-p))^{n} is when p=q.
E[X+Y] = 2n when p+q=1
(n-X) \sim B(n,1-p)
X(1-Y) \sim B(1,p(1-q)) when n=1
P(X=x,Y=y) = P(XY = xy)
